Poor people falling dead like worms after drinking spurious liquor
The last two days in Kerala have been witnessing pathetic scenes with the death by now of 23 persons after drinking spurious liquor in the Malabar area.
The pity is that all of them are poor people.

Vidya Stokes elected president of Hockey India
Vidya Stokes has been elected president of Hockey India.
There are two Malayalis in the governing body. Mariamma Koshy is the vice-president and Ramesh Nambiar joint secretary.
